In addition to the NPA, agencies that certify phlebotomy candidates include the American Credentialing Agency, the American Society for Clinical Pathologies Board of Certification, American Medical Technologists, the National Center for Competency Testing, and the National Healthcareer Association. Certificate programs are between six months to one year in duration and are offered in hospitals, trade and technical schools, community colleges, and junior colleges. Although California and Louisiana are the only states that require it, most employers favor certification and more may require it later on. There are several educational paths you'll be able to choose that end with certification, though.
Once you complete your online training courses, you will need to pass various tests conducted by the American Society for Clinical Pathology (ASCP), the American Medical Technologists and American Association of Medical Staff, to be a certified phlebotomist.
